DESCRIPTION:Please join 21c\, the University of Kentucky School of Architecture\, and the Southern California Institute of Architecture on Monday\, October 7th from 6-9pm for a panel discussion around our new exhibit “Museum of the Future\,” which examines the future role of the museum in society through innovative and even radical forms of architecture. Moderators and panelists include curators\, professors\, institutional directors\, and architects from Kentucky as well as across the country. \n> Monday Oct. 7\n> 6-9pm\n> 21c Museum Hotel\, Louisville\n> Cash bar and light bites available \nABOUT Museum of the Future \n21c Louisville is excited to exhibit “Museum of the Future” in partnership with the University of Kentucky School of Architecture and the Southern California Institute of Architecture (SCI_Arc). \nStemming from questions on how we conceive a ‘museum of the future’ and what future roles the museum will have in society\, this exhibition explores potential solutions for museums with growing collections that are too large to share with the public\, prompting the creation of innovative and even radical new forms of architecture that could be part museum\, part storage facility\, part event space\, and part community social space.

DESCRIPTION:Discover Louisville’s Prohibition past on a haunted cocktail & food tour down Whiskey Row. \nBook your tour here!\n\nUse code “thingstolou5” to save 5%!\n  \nVenture out with us and explore the hidden stories of Louisville’s haunted past. As you eat and drink your way down Whiskey Row\, you’ll meet the resident ghosts of Louisville’s historic downtown\, trace the footsteps of bourbon magnates and mobsters\, see Al Capone’s secret getaway\, discover hidden speakeasies\, and learn the shocking truth about Prohibition. \n  \nWhat to Expect\nThis tour includes 4 stops for libations\, as well as an assortment of small bites. Here’s what else to expect: \nBourbon & Cocktails\nThis is a boozy\, 21+ tour\, y’all. \nAudio Headset​\nTo help you hear us from a distance. \nSmall Group\nOur tours max out at 12 people. \nWalking\n1-1.5 Miles. Wear comfy shoes! \nExplore Whiskey Row: \nDistilleries. Speakeasies. Saloons. In the mid-1800’s\, this stretch of Main Street was filled to the brim with bourbon barrels – which would soon be considered contraband. While this area nearly crumbled to disrepair\, today the historic facades house bourbon distilleries\, bars\, restaurants and hotels. \nWhere\nMeet at 1st and Washington St\, Louisville\, KY \nWhen​\nTuesdays – Fridays\, 5:00 and 5:30 PM \n

DESCRIPTION:Discover Louisville’s Deepest\, darkest secrets. \nBook your tour here!\n\nUse code “thingstolou5” to save 5%!\n  \nStep into the shadows of the past on a haunting history tour through the heart of downtown Louisville. As the sun sets and the city’s vibrant façade fades\, you’ll uncover the sinister secrets and chilling tales that lurk behind the historic architecture & storied streets. \nOne part ghosts\, one part grisly history that is\, sadly\, entirely true\, this guided 1.5-hour walking tour through downtown Louisville unveils the deepest\, darkest corners of Louisville’s gruesome past. Wander through dimly lit alleyways behind bustling Whiskey Row and along the shores of the murky Ohio River\, where the echoes of bygone eras resound with tragic tales of the forlorn\, the oppressed\, the betrayed\, and the ruthless. \n\nDistance: 1.5 miles\nDuration: 1.5 hours\nStops: 1 bathroom stop. Drinks & snacks available for purchase.\nCapacity: 20 people max per tour\nTime: Evenings\, Tuesdays-Sundays\nAccessibility: Wheelchair friendly \n\nWhat’s This Tour All About?\nFrom a ghost that still haunts a glamorous hotel to the tragic riots of Bloody Monday\, you’ll trace the cursed footsteps of criminals\, mobsters\, bootleggers\, enslavers\, and murderers in the city streets they once roamed. \nLed by expert storytellers\, this immersive walking tour delves into the darker chapters of Louisville’s history. Our tour explores the sort of history only told in whispers\, from notorious criminals and bootleggers who once ran Louisville’s underworld to what lies beneath the quiet waters of the Ohio River – and the spirits whose souls never left. \nOver the course of two thrilling hours\, your guide will tell the tales of… \n\nCunning bootleggers who defied Prohibition\nSalacious tunnels beneath Whiskey Row\nFires\, floods\, and plagues that ripped through the city leaving a wake of destruction\nUnsolved murders and shocking scandals\nThe tragic riots of Bloody Monday

DESCRIPTION:Come out with us and explore the queer stories of Louisville’s past and present as you eat and drink your way down Bardstown Road\, Louisville’s gay epicenter! \n  \nBook your tour here!\n\nUse code “thingstolou5” to save 5%!\n  \nAs you stroll through the lush avenues of historic Cherokee Triangle\, you’ll taste classic Kentucky bites such as fried chicken\, spoonbread\, and a Louisville Hot Brown paired with refreshing cocktails (or mocktails). Along the way\, you’ll uncover the diverse history of Kentucky’s Queer folx\, from a Black Prohibition-era drag queen to the poets\, authors\, and activists that paved the way for Kentucky’s Queer community. You’ll end your tour where the rest of your night begins\, at the city’s best gay bars. \n\nDistance: 1.5 miles\, flat\nDuration: 3 hours\nFood Stops: 4 stops for local dishes & drinks\nCapacity: 12 per tour\nTime: 5-8 PM\nAccessibility: Wheelchair and stroller friendly \n\nExplore the Highlands\nThe Highlands is one of Louisville’s oldest neighborhoods – and its most quirky. As the gay epicenter of Louisville\, it’s also home to the annual Louisville Pride Festival\, and several of Louisville’s best gay bars – in fact\, your tour will leave you right by them to continue your evening! \nWhere\nMeet outside of 1321 Bardstown Rd\, Louisville\, KY 40204 \nWhen​\nWeds – Friday\, 6-8:30 PM \n\nWhat’s This Tour All About?\nIs it a food tour or a queer history tour? The answer\, of course\, is both! This tour is the perfect blend of tastes and tales\, exploring Louisville and Kentucky’s LBTQ+ history and queer community along with a taste of its culinary heritage. \nOver the 3 hours you’ll spend with us\, you’ll get … \n\n4 Delicious dishes representing Louisville & Kentucky\n5 Refreshing bourbon cocktails\nFascinating stories of Kentucky’s queer history and its home-grown artists\, authors\, and activists\nAudio headset (to help you hear your guide)\n\n

DESCRIPTION:Walking Food\, History & Architecture Tour through the historic Highlands \nBook your tour here!\n\nUse code “thingstolou5” to save 5%!\n  \nStroll through the historic Original Highlands and Cherokee Triangle neighborhoods savoring the story of Louisville and Kentucky through its cuisine. \nAs you walk along some of Louisville’s oldest and most iconic streets\, you’ll taste (and drink) delicious local specialties; visit the iconic entrance of Cave Hill Cemetery\, the final resting place of Muhammad Ali and Colonel Sanders; try a dish inspired by the Hot Brown in Muhammed Ali’s former boxing gym; sip bourbon in Louisville’s oldest bar; trace the footsteps of the immigrants who shaped the city; and admire opulent Victorian homes and historic architecture near stunning Cherokee Park. \n\nDistance: 1.5 miles\, flat\nDuration: 3 hours\nFood Stops: 5 stops for local dishes & drinks\nCapacity: 12 per tour\nTime: 1:30 PM\, Weds-Sundays\nAccessibility: Wheelchair and stroller friendly \n\nExplore the Highlands\nThe Highlands is one of Louisville’s oldest neighborhoods – and its most quirky. Historic Victorian homes branch off of the quirky Bardstown Road thoroughfare\, lined with vibrant murals\, eclectic shops and hip local restaurants & bars stretching all the way to Bourbon country. \nWhere\nMeet at 956 Baxter Ave\, Louisville\, KY 40204 \nWhen​\nWeds – Sunday\, 1:30-4:30 PM
